Witchcraft Through the Ages
(Häxän)

Screening on Film
Directed by Benjamin Christensen .
With Maren Pedersen, Clara Pontoppidan, Elith Pio.
Demark/Sweden, 1922, 35mm, black & white, silent, 87 min.

Swedish filmmaker Benjamin Christensen explores the mysteries of witchcraft in this famed documentary study. Although the film relies on etchings and manuscripts to prove its findings on the subject the film is often wickedly hilarious and thoroughly entertaining in its efforts to capture the hysteria of the Middle Ages. Christensen employs a variety of filmic techniques including bizarre reenactments in which the director himself appears as the Devil.
